Transaction 20060600d58acf66dd94035aa8fb00041665843ac210165008f35b0f938d8516
1 Input
1 Output
-
20060600d58acf66dd94035aa8fb00041665843ac210165008f35b0f938d8516:0
- value
- 610358
- script pubkey
- OP_0 OP_PUSHBYTES_20 45afbb8a01b58cfd30aaa490ea4775f0add7acb4
- address
- bc1qgkhmhzspkkx06v925jgw53m47zka0t958ymfpa